Probiotics MCB6424 Exam 3 Questions with Complete Solutions (Latest 2025) Specific functions of the microbiota - Correct Answers ✅seal body spaces, mitigate intestinal pathogens, maintain tissue homeostasis, facilitate fermentation of dietary fiber (pectin, etc), critical energy yield, metabolic end products and therapeutic drug processing, signaling among cells and organ systems (butyrate - energy for gut epithelial cells; acetate and propionate - lipogenesis and methods to study the microbiota - Correct Answers ✅16S rRNA gene sequencing-based surveys and shotgun metagenomic approach 16S rRNA gene sequencing-based surveys - Correct Answers ✅Gene contains highly conserved regions and variable regions amplify 16S rRNA genes using primers directed at conserved regions but flanking variable regions align gene sequences, resolve phylogenetic relationships at different depths Most 16S rRNA sequences come from previously ____ - Correct Answers ✅undescribed microbes Operational Taxonomic Units - Correct Answers ✅a definition used to classify groups of closely related individuals Sequences are clustered according to their similarity to one another
